Staffed: 6am–10pm Merrylands railway station is a heritage-listed railway station located on the Main South line, serving the Sydney suburb of Merrylands.

It is served by Sydney Trains' T2 Leppington & Inner West and T5 Cumberland line services.

[3][4] In 1969, the Merrylands Road level crossing to the south of the station was replaced by the Mombri Street overpass to the north.

[5] On 2 November 1996, the Merrylands to Harris Park Y-Link opened allowing direct train operation between these two stations by what is now known as the Cumberland Line.

[7] Until at least the mid-1990s, sidings existed to the north-west of the station to serve a flour mill.
